SUBJECT: SOUTHEAST TURKEY PRESS SUMMARY APRIL 23-26, 2004


This is the Southeastern Turkey press summary for April 23-26,
2004. Please note that Turkish press reports often contain
errors or exaggerations; AmConsulate Adana does not vouch for
the accuracy of the reports summarized here.


POLITICAL, SECURITY, HUMAN RIGHTS


Milli Gazete, Vakit, / Diyarbakir Governorate sued Ahmet
Guvener, a Turkish Christian, for building a church illegally.
U.S Ankara Embassy Economic Counselor Scott Marciel visited the
Diyarbakir Public Prosecutor on April 22 to get information
about the case. Allegedly, Guvener is reported to have received
approximately $80,000 from European countries for the building
of the church.


Ulkede Gundem / In Van, Jandarma detained 91 people who entered
Turkey illegally. The detainees are from Pakistan, Bangladesh,
and Afghanistan.


Bolge, Turkiye, Zaman / The Young Turkish Youth Parliament will
be inaugurated on May 19, 2004. Members had their first meeting
in Tarsus.
